Abstract

Tanjung Belit landfill waste processing operations use a controlled landfil system, this is indicated by the presence of garbage collection ponds and leachate collection channels, but in the rainy season there is difficulty in accessing roads causing waste to be dumped outside the garbage collection pond, so that the TPA applies an open dumping system trash transported is immediately disposed of and stacked on land near the landfill. Waste deposits will produce a liquid known as lindi (leachate). This study aims to identify the effect of leachate from Tanjung Belit Landfill (TPA) on water quality around Tanjung Belit landfill. Samples were taken as many as 5 samples, namely leachate, monitoring well water and river water around the landfill where the parameters measured were pH, DO, TDS, BOD, COD, Nitrite, Sulphate and Chloride based on PP No. 82 of 2001 and KEPMEN LH No.51 of 1995 concerning Liquid Waste Quality Standards. The results of the analysis show that the leachate of Tanjung Belit landfill affects the quality of river water and monitoring well water around the Tanjung Belit landfill but is still classified as lightly polluted. The influence of distance on the quality of sunagi water and monitoring well water, namely the farther the distance, the less contamination in water.
